The One With The Intimate Reunion
Whether you're a Ross and Rachel or a Monica and Chandler, this 'Friends'-themed roleplay scenario invites couples to create their own episode filled with laughter and love. - You and your partner decide to spend an evening as your favorite 'Friends' couple. For the nostalgic duo, perhaps Ross and Rachel, with the ups and downs of their legendary relationship, allowing for playful banter and the iconic 'we were on a break' moment. For those who admire stability, a Monica and Chandler dynamic might be more fitting, with both warm affection and quirky competitiveness.
- Transform your living space into your own version of Central Perk. If Ross and Rachel, one of you could pretend to 'accidentally' spill coffee on the other, igniting a flirtatious exchange. If you opt for Monica and Chandler, engage in a silly bet or game that ends with a romantic wager. Improvisation is key – the script of the night is yours to create, leading to moments of humor, connection, and intimacy.
- As the evening unfolds, incorporate beloved aspects of the show into your roleplay. Recreate the 'pivot' scene while maneuvering a faux couch, or have a mock 'smelly cat' performance. The goal is to keep the theme light and joyful, allowing both of you to connect through shared laughter and create your own 'episode' to remember.
Preparation steps:
- To prepare, choose your favorite 'Friends' couple and spend an afternoon binge-watching episodes highlighting their best moments. Observe their quirks, catchphrases, and the nuances that make their interactions memorable. This will aid you in getting into character and creating an authentic experience.
- Decorate your living area to resemble the set. Whether it's Central Perk with its iconic couch or the girls' apartment with its purple door, add touches that recall the show's setting. You can create a playlist with the show's soundtrack, including 'I'll Be There for You' to set the mood.
- Decide on the attire. If you're channeling Ross, a sweater vest or a leather pants mishap could be hilarious. For Rachel, perhaps the iconic waitress apron or one of her chic outfits. Monica might sport a chef's coat while Chandler could don his sweater vests or an '80s flashback outfit.

Some tips:
- Remember that roleplay should be fun and comfortable for both parties. Ensure that each partner is happy with their role and the scenarios you're going to act out.
- Use inside jokes or personal memories to intertwine your relationship with the roleplay, making it unique and special to you as a couple.
- Don't take it too seriously – the point of this themed roleplay is to laugh and bond over a shared love of a cultural phenomenon that's all about friendship and relationships.
